Transaction 63576498616140a5e221d4c83ca3ab9bca2b741e023fa4517e594907d6cf8169

1 Input
2 Outputs
  • 63576498616140a5e221d4c83ca3ab9bca2b741e023fa4517e594907d6cf8169:0
  • value  2517245
    address  1A1enKRpjgV9SrDMY3dZsCoh1X5m58sb7G
  • 63576498616140a5e221d4c83ca3ab9bca2b741e023fa4517e594907d6cf8169:1
  • value  9251358
    address  37DhMvohyeFzmUfmSuofCGG2XzEjNj8PZF